Lisaa is a variant of the name Lisa, which itself is a diminutive of Elizabeth. Elizabeth originates from the Hebrew name Elisheva, meaning 'God is my oath' or 'consecrated to God.' Historically, Elizabeth has been a popular name in various cultures due to its biblical roots, symbolizing faithfulness and divine promise.

Elizabeth I of England

Queen of England and Ireland who established Protestantism and defeated the Spanish Armada

Saint Elizabeth of Hungary

Princess known for her charitable works and deep faith, canonized as a saint

Elizabeth Barrett Browning

Renowned English poet whose works influenced Victorian literature
